| Viet Nam hosts
ASEAN Trade Fair 2004 to promote cooperation |
|
This year's ASEAN Trade Fair is introducing regional economic
achievements to a global audience while demonstrating the
determination of member countries to strengthen their
cooperation and to establish an integrated economic
environment, said Deputy Prime Minister Vu Khoan on Tuesday at
the ASEAN Trade Fair 2004.
In his opening speech for one of Viet Nam's largest ever
trade fairs, Khoan said business exchanges and trade fairs
play an important role in establishing an ASEAN Economic
Community.
"Planned for the sidelines of the Asia-Europe Meeting (ASEM
5), the ASEAN Trade Fair 2004 sends a strong message that
Viet Nam wants to strengthen its relationship with the
outside world, with Europe as its foremost partner," said
Khoan.
Trade Minister Truong Dinh Tuyen added that the fair was not
only an important trade promotion event among ASEAN members,
but also a golden opportunity for ASEM business cooperation.
"The fair presents promising opportunities for ASEAN
businesses to reaffirm their prestige and presence in the
regional and international markets by making their own brand
names widely recognised," said Tuyen.
Tuyen believed the fair will create new developments for
cooperation among ASEAN and non-ASEAN businesses.
The trade fair covers an area of 20,000 sq.m and features
ten national representative pavilions from ten members of
the Association of Southeast Asian Nations (ASEAN). In
addition, the fairground includes 600 booths for businesses
from 20 countries, including ASEAN members, the EU, the US,
China, India and Pakistan. Organisers expect to welcome
10,000 business people and more than 100,000 Vietnamese and
foreign visitors.
The fair will focus on what are considered the
highest-potential ASEAN product areas of electronics,
electricity, interior decoration, fashion and agriculture.
The ASEAN Business Forum and ASEAN Night have both been
organised on the sidelines of the fair.
According to Tuyen, regional economic ministers and
international experts in building and advertising trademarks
will attend the ASEAN Business Forum, which will provide
ASEAN economic officials and businesses with opportunities
to exchange their knowledge and experiences, to share views
and to discuss the role of entrepreneurs in regional
cooperation.
Meanwhile, ASEAN countries will also have an opportunity to
exchange ideas with ASEM-5 participants and introduce their
unique cultures on ASEAN Night.
The biennial ASEAN Trade Fairs is a significant trade
promotion activity within the cooperation framework of ASEAN
members. The event is designed to promote commercial
exchange, to enhance multi-sided cooperation and to
introduce the image of an ASEAN group rich in trade, tourism
and investment potential.
The fair, organised by the Ministry of Trade will last until
Oct. 10.

Asem Youth Forum on
Sustainable Development
From 28th June to 2nd July 2004,
the “ASEM Youth Forum on Sustainable Development:
Strengthening Youth Cooperation between Asia and
Europe” was held in Ha Noi, Viet Nam. The forum
was organized by Viet Nam’s Youth National
Committee and the Asia-Europe Foundation (ASEF).
That was the third event organized in Viet Nam
among activities towards ASEM 5 Summit Meeting,
which will be held in Ha Noi in October 2004 and
the first activity co-hosted by ASEF and Viet Nam
on the occasion of the Summit. |

VIETNAM - An Active
Member of ASEM
In pursuit of a foreign policy of
openness, multilateralization and diversification
of foreign relations, Vietnam has been actively
integrating itself into the region and the world.
Having become a member of the Association of
Southeast Asian Nations (ASEAN) in July 1995 and
being aware of the potential for cooperation in
investment, trade, science and technology, and
human resources development between Asia and
Europe, Vietnam has made contribution to giving
birth to Asia-Europe Meeting (ASEM) and was one of
the 26 founding partners of the process at the
inaugural Asia-Europe Meeting (ASEM 1) held in
Bangkok, Thailand in March 1996. |
